This week, the Weekly Pokémon Broadcasting Station shows another variety show. This episode premieres a new segment, "Thrilling Pokémon Videos". See thrilling and exciting scenes shown in rapid succession: The daring escape from a sunken ship, an encounter with a poltergeist and the rescue of children from a burning building.
In "Rankings of Anything and Everything Pokémon", we look at which Pokémon made us laugh the mostin the past. We present Pokémon doing funny faces, Pokémon telling jokes, Pokémon playing the straight man... Metapyon and Sonansu make for good shows, but the funniest of all is of course the natural clown - Koduck.
The Rocket Gang again crashes the studio to host their own ranking. Many have requested we look at the painful memories of the trio, so here they showcase clips including scenes of them getting lost in the snowy mountains, and them pondering their position in life.
In "Pokémon de English", we learn the phrase "Thank goodness!", the English equivalent of よかった - not to be mixed up with the phrase "That was excellent!", the English equivalent of よくやった
Finally, in the Request Corner, we clear up the often asked question of how the Rocket Gang Nyarth can talk the human language, going through the sad memories of his past as told in episode 72.
